GPU利用率 - 智学轩城

GPU利用率

GPU利用率就是GPU在处理任务时的使用程度。简单说,就是GPU有多忙。比如,利用率90%就意味着GPU现在正忙到快饱和了。利用率高,代表你的游戏或应用跑得快,但也可能因为过热或者过载导致性能不稳定。

说起来GPU利用率这事儿,我还真有几句心里话。记得大概是在2016年吧,那时候我刚开始在这个问答论坛行业混,那时候的GPU利用率还真是让我吃了不少苦头。
说实话,那时候很多朋友都在抱怨,说自己的服务器GPU利用率总是上不去,一问才知道,很多人都是用CPU做深度学习,然后GPU只是个摆设。我当时也没想明白,为什么深度学习这东西,CPU跟GPU差距那么大。
后来,我专门研究了一下,发现了一个挺有意思的现象。那时候的GPU利用率,平均下来也就30%到40%的样子。我记得有个朋友,他的团队在搞图像识别,他们那时候的GPU利用率只有20%,这简直是浪费了。后来,我给他们推荐了一些优化GPU利用率的技巧,比如调整批处理大小、使用更高效的算法啥的,结果他们GPU利用率直接翻倍。
有意思的是,随着时间推移,GPU利用率这个数字也在慢慢变化。我记得2020年左右,因为深度学习、人工智能这波热潮,很多企业开始重视GPU利用率这个问题。那时候,一些领先的科技公司,比如谷歌、英伟达,他们提出的GPU利用率已经能达到80%以上了。这数字,放在我当年那会儿是想都不敢想的。
GPU利用率这事儿,就是一个不断进步的过程。现在,更多的普通人开始用了,GPU利用率自然也就提高了。不过,我还是觉得,这块儿还有很多提升空间,毕竟技术这东西,永远都是在进步的。数据我记得是X左右,但建议你核实一下最新的研究。

GPU利用率,就是GPU多忙,是不是满载运行。简单说,就是用GPU多不多,用得怎么样。我上周刚处理一个项目,发现GPU利用率只有20%,其实就是配置太低,任务不够多。你自己的看,是不是需要升级配置或者加多点工作。